default xkb_compatibility "xtest" { // Minimal set of symbol interpretations to provide // reasonable behavior for testing. // The X Test Suite assumes that it can set any modifier // by simulating a KeyPress and clear it by simulating a // KeyRelease. Because of the way that XKB implements // locking/latching modifiers, this approach fails in // some cases (typically the Lock or NumLock modifiers). // These symbol interpretations make all modifier keys // just set the corresponding modifier so that xtest // will see the behavior it expects. virtual_modifiers NumLock,AltGr; interpret.repeat= False; setMods.clearLocks= True; latchMods.clearLocks= True; latchMods.latchToLock= False; interpret Shift_Lock+AnyOf(Shift+Lock) { action= SetMods(modifiers=Shift); }; interpret Num_Lock+Any { virtualModifier= NumLock; action= SetMods(modifiers=NumLock); }; interpret Mode_switch { useModMapMods= level1; virtualModifier= AltGr; action= SetGroup(group=2); }; interpret Any + Any { action= SetMods(modifiers=modMapMods); }; group 2 = AltGr; group 3 = AltGr; group 4 = AltGr; indicator.allowExplicit= False; indicator "Caps Lock" { modifiers= Lock; }; indicator "Num Lock" { modifiers= NumLock; }; indicator "Shift Lock" { whichModState= Locked; modifiers= Shift; }; indicator.allowExplicit= True; };
